Many UK brides weigh up a trip to Pakistan against ordering online closer to home. Both are valid — here's an honest comparison to help you decide.
Buying in Pakistan
Pros:
- See and feel everything in person before buying.
- Enormous selection across markets and designers.
- Potentially lower base prices, especially with local knowledge.
- A meaningful family experience if you're travelling anyway.
Cons:
- Requires the time and cost of travel.
- You manage shipping home — and potentially UK customs and duties yourself.
- Tailoring is done there; later alterations in the UK can be harder.
- Quality and pricing vary hugely; it helps to know the market.

Frequently asked questions
Is it cheaper to buy bridal wear in Pakistan?
Base prices can be lower, especially with local knowledge — but you must factor in travel, shipping home and potentially handling UK customs and duties yourself. Online from a UK brand often wins on total cost and convenience.
Is it better to buy in Pakistan or online from the UK?
Buying in Pakistan suits those travelling anyway who want to see everything in person; online from a UK-registered brand suits those who value convenience, transparent pricing, a guaranteed fit and duties-included delivery.
What are the risks of buying in Pakistan?
Variable quality and pricing, managing your own shipping and UK customs, and the difficulty of later alterations in the UK. Local knowledge helps reduce these.
